Ireland · Question · written

PQ 536

559 Mr. Perry asked the Minister for Communications, Marine and Natural Resources if he has examined the implications of the Foreshore Act 1933 with regard to today’s planning environment; if he has examined the implications of the Act in view of the fact that it does not provide for the statutory involvement of local authorities or for any right of public appeal;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[15097/07]
